Lignin is a type of complex organic polymer that is found in the support tissues of most plants and serves as a structural substance. Because they offer stiffness and do not rot easily, lignin is particularly crucial in the construction of cell walls, notably in wood and bark. Lignin is a polymer formed by cross-linking phenolic precursors in a chemical reaction. In the production of paper, lignin is removed from wood pulp using agents such as sulphur dioxide, sodium sulphide, or sodium hydroxide. Lignin is used in a variety of industrial applications, including as a binder for particleboard and other laminated or composite wood products, as a soil conditioner, as a filler or active ingredient in phenolic resins, and as a linoleum adhesive.

MARKET SEGMENTATION
The global lignin market is segmented into category and application. By category, the lignin market is classified into sulphur bearing lignin and sulphur-free lignin. The sulphur bearing lignin is further classified into Kraft lignin, sulphite lignin, and others. By application, the lignin market is classified into plastic, binder, carbon fibers, motor fuel, others.
